Garcia's Assisted Living Home LLC Costs & Pricing

Garcia's Assisted Living Home LLC offers competitive pricing for its private rooms at $2,000 per month, significantly lower than both the Maricopa County average of $3,318 and the state average of $3,345. This pricing strategy not only positions Garcia's as an affordable option for families seeking quality care but also highlights its commitment to accessibility without compromising on service. By providing a more cost-effective alternative in comparison to the broader market, Garcia's aims to support residents and their families in navigating the often high expense associated with assisted living facilities while ensuring a conducive environment for comfort and care.

    • Board and Care Home Board and Care HomeBoard and care homes provide a smaller, more intimate setting for seniors who require assistance with daily tasks but do not need the level of care offered by a nursing home. They offer personalized care, meals, and social activities in a homelike environment, ensuring that seniors receive individualized attention and support in their golden years.
